FSR Shim Eliminates Brake Squeal and Vibration
The tri-layer FSR shim (Fibre, Steel, Rubber) bonds to the backing plate and dampens high-frequency vibration that causes brake squeal. Unlike single-layer shims or pads with no shim at all, the FSR design isolates pad vibration from the caliper, dramatically reducing the chance of that embarrassing squeal when pulling into the driveway or braking gently in car parks. The steel layer provides structural rigidity while fibre and rubber layers absorb vibration energy.

BED-IN Coating Accelerates Break-In and Quiets Operation
The factory-applied BED-IN coating (visible as a dark surface layer on new pads) transfers material to the rotor surface during the first 200-300 km of driving, speeding up the bedding process and establishing optimal pad-to-rotor contact faster than uncoated pads. This coating reduces initial brake dust, minimises early-life squeal, and helps achieve full braking performance within the first few hundred kilometres. The included anti-squeal paste further suppresses noise by filling microscopic gaps between pad and caliper.

Frequently Asked Questions

What vehicles does RDB1468 fit?
Pad application is vehicle-specific by chassis code and year. Verify fitment using RDA's online fitment guide with your vehicle's VIN, or contact F.A.E. with your vehicle make, model, year, and engine to confirm RDB1468 compatibility before ordering.

Can I use these pads with slotted or drilled rotors?
Yes, RDA GP Max pads are compatible with standard cast iron rotors, slotted rotors, and cross-drilled rotors. The low metallic compound provides appropriate friction characteristics for all common rotor surface types used in street applications.

How long does bedding-in take with the BED-IN coating?
The BED-IN coating accelerates bedding to approximately 200-300 km of normal driving. Expect full braking performance within this distance. Avoid aggressive braking or sustained hard stops during the first 200 km to allow proper pad-to-rotor material transfer.

Are these pads suitable for towing or track use?
GP Max pads suit light-to-moderate towing (up to rated vehicle tow capacity) and general street use. For regular heavy towing, frequent mountain driving, or track use, consider RDA's upgraded compound options (Hawk, XT, or performance-specific pads) with higher temperature ratings.

Do I need to replace rotors when fitting new pads?
Not necessarily. If rotors are within minimum thickness specification, have no cracks or heat checking, and can be machined to restore a flat surface, they can be reused. Replace rotors if below minimum thickness, warped beyond machining limits, or showing heat damage.
